Why Coding Alone Won't Save You in the AI Era
AI is reshaping software engineering, making diverse skills more essential than ever. Coding isn't enough anymore.
AI is turning the software engineering world on its head, and Kelsey Hightower, a former Google distinguished engineer, has a message for developers: diversify your skills or risk being left behind. On 'The Pragmatic Engineer' podcast, Hightower laid it out plainly. The divide isn't just about who can code. It's about who can make impactful decisions.
A New Skillset is Needed
Hightower highlighted a essential shift. Developers who've relied solely on coding prowess are finding themselves at a crossroads. 'You thought being the only coder in the room made you safe,' he told host Gergely Orosz. 'But now coding is commoditized.' AI's rise means that the unique value of knowing how to code is diminishing. The real differentiators? Skills like networking, product management, and customer interactions.
This isn't just Hightower's view. It's a growing sentiment across Silicon Valley. Judgment and what's often called 'taste' are becoming key. Companies need people who decide what to build, not just how to build it. It's a notion echoed by tech leaders like Y Combinator's Paul Graham and OpenAI's Greg Brockman. Salesforce's Marc Benioff and Duolingo's Luis von Ahn agree too. AI might be great at tasks, but it can't replace the subtleties of human communication and relationship-building.
The Evolution of Software Engineering
According to Hightower, software engineering is morphing into a discipline centered on decision-making. 'If you're a full-stack engineer, you're probably realizing it's not just about writing code,' he said. Embracing tools like AI allows developers to focus on broader aspects of their roles. 'I love having Claude,' he added, referring to the AI tool, 'because I can prioritize decisions over execution.'
So, what does this all mean for the software industry? The press release said AI transformation. The employee survey said otherwise. The gap between the keynote and the cubicle is enormous. For developers, the takeaway is clear: expand your skillset. In an AI-driven world, coding alone won't cut it. Are you ready to step up?
Get AI news in your inbox
Daily digest of what matters in AI.